The primary function of a silicone surfactant in rigid PU foam formulation is to stabilize the foam during its critical expansion and solidification phases. This is achieved through their unique ability to reduce surface tension within the reacting mixture. This reduction in surface tension allows for the formation of finer, more uniform cells, which is paramount for achieving excellent thermal insulation. For instance, improving the thermal insulation performance of refrigerator insulation is directly linked to the surfactant's ability to create a consistent, closed-cell structure, minimizing heat transfer. Beyond thermal insulation, the dimensional stability that a well-chosen silicone surfactant imparts is crucial. Rigid PU foam, especially when used in construction panels or appliance casings, must maintain its shape under varying environmental conditions. The surfactant's role in creating a uniform cell network prevents internal stresses that can lead to warping or shrinkage, ensuring the product's long-term integrity.
